Samsung Refrigerator Error Code R-1 (R DEF Heater)
R-DEF heater part error
What the R-1 (R DEF Heater) error code actually means
Your Samsung refrigerator is showing an error because the defrost heater in the fresh food section is not working correctly. The heater may be broken, disconnected, or the refrigerator failed to finish its defrost cycle in the expected amount of time. This can lead to ice buildup inside and the refrigerator not cooling properly.

Most common causes of R-1 (R DEF Heater)
- 1Defrost heater open circuit or failure
- 2Blown thermal fuse
- 3Loose or corroded connector at CN70 or CN71
- 4Short circuit in heater wiring or element
- 5Excessive ice buildup preventing defrost completion
